Western films and television have glamorized the dangerous life of cowboys and outlaws, riding horses and slinging guns through windy desert towns. White cowboys and gunslingers, that is. Many Black heroes have been lost to history, including cowboys, deputies, and settlers who found their way in the Wild West after Emancipation. Guest: James Otis Smith, illustrator and author of "Black Heroes of the Wild West; Featuring Stagecoach Mary, Bass Reeves, and Bob Lemmons"
